    This sweet mushroom themed play place in Orangevale might be our 1 year old's new favorite indoor…read moreplayground! For 2 hours straight she was playing with wooden toys, rocking babies, walking, crawling, climbing, babbling and even socializing with another baby! Our toddler's middle name is Arwen after the half-elf in Lord of the Rings, so of course my husband and I got a kick out of their wooden hobbit playhouse! This Waldorf inspired playroom opened in January by a sweet mom of 3 with an educational background! They cater specifically to ages 0-5 years, but older siblings are welcome as well! Open Play is $15 for ages 1 and up, $12 for siblings, with 1 parent included and $5 each additional parent! They host parties for a fee with themed decor and balloons! Waivers can be signed conviently online to save time before visits and they sell grip socks as well in their boutique/snack area! Free cubbies, plenty of seating and couches with books to read to your children! Best of all they allow outside food and drink in their seating area with free use of their microwave and Keurig machine!     Such a cute place! It's very aesthetically pleasing and has a variety of toys and costumes to play…read morewith. I think it's good for ages 0-10. There are adult chairs throughout the playroom to sit in while your child plays. The toys seemed clean and the playroom wasn't messy. There are little houses for children to play in. They have push cart/play food stands to play with which I thought was unique. They also have a mini trampoline which I've never seen in an indoor playroom before. There is only one mini slide here, so that's something to be aware of if your child prefers slides. Adults and children can wear their shoes in here since they have hardwood floors. The separate birthday room was really nice and very open. I definitely plan to have my daughter's birthday party here in the future.
